作 者:宋华庭 王建立 陈翼 朱永长 Song Huating;Wang Jianli;Chen Yi;Zhu Yongchang(Sinoma Internal Engineering Co.,Ltd.,Nanjing,211100,China)
机构地区:[1]中国中材国际工程股份有限公司(南京),江苏南京211100
出 处:《水泥工程》2024年第6期1-4,14,共5页Cement Engineering
摘 要:SCR脱硝反应器的高效运行依赖于催化剂表面流场的均匀性,但由于水泥窑SCR反应器特有的结构形式,在不采取优化措施的情况下,必然出现催化剂表面流场不均的问题。采用数值模拟对水泥窑SCR反应器内流场开展了计算,研究入口弯管形式和导流板对阻力和流场均匀性的影响。结果表明:设置弯管导流板可改善弯管出口的偏流问题,变截面弯管的阻力比等截面弯管小;渐扩段设置导流板后,催化剂表面速度均匀性得到显著改善,设置双层导流板时,催化剂表面速度均匀性可以达到规范要求;随着导流板间距的增大,阻力呈先降低后平稳的变化趋势,速度均匀性无明显的变化规律;随着导流板V型夹角的增大,阻力逐步上升,速度相对标准偏差随夹角的增大呈先下降后上升的变化趋势。High efficient denitration of SCR reactor relies on homogeneous flow field distribution of the catalyst surface.However,without implementing optimization measures,the unique structure of the SCR reactor in cement industry inevitably leads to an uneven flow field at the catalyst surface.The flow field in the SCR reactor of a cement factory was computed through numerical simulation,and a detailed investigation was conducted on the impact of different bend pipe configurations and guide plate settings on pressure drop and flow uniformity.The findings demonstrate that the bias flow at the outlet of the bend pipe can be improved by setting a turning vanes in the bend pipe.Moreover,the resistance of the variable cross-section bend is smaller than that of the constant cross-section bend.The uniformity of catalyst surface velocity is improved significantly after the guide plates are set in the gradual expansion section.By incorporating double layer guide plates into the gradual expansion section,the uniformity of catalyst surface velocity can meet the technical specification.With the increase of the distance between guide plates,the pressure drop decreases at first and then shows no obvious change,and the velocity uniformity has no obvious change.As V-shaped angle of guide plate increases,the pressure drop gradually increases,and the relative standard deviation of the flow velocity decreases first and then increases.
